Un voyage en Algérie vu comme une méditation sur le paysage et le destin humain. Le récit suit un voyageur qui arrive à Alger et qui observe les rues, les marchés, les rencontres et les gestes simples qui tissent la vie quotidienne dans le Sahel et l’Atlas. À travers des descriptions sensorielles et des rencontres colorées, le livre mêle mémoire personnelle et observation du monde qui l’entoure.
Ce journal de voyage offre une immersion profonde dans des lieux et des personnages, où la frontière entre fiction et reminiscence se fait légère. Entre scènes de rue, portraits de personnages et réflexions artistiques, le texte explore la façon dont le paysage façonne l’esprit et le récit.
Idéal pour les lecteurs de récits de voyage littéraires et de classiques du XIXe siècle qui aiment l’équilibre entre récit personnel et description du monde extérieur.

Paperback. Etat : New. Print on Demand. This book is an exquisite account of the author's year abroad spent in 19th century Algeria under French rule. The author, a keen observer of the Algerian people and landscape, takes readers on a journey through a tumultuous and fascinating period in the country's history. The collected journal entries provide a unique vantage point into the social and political dynamics between Algeria's Arab population and their French colonizers. The author provides an insightful study of the tension, and violence of colonialism and offers a nuanced portrait of the people in between two worlds.
